Job Description:
This job is responsible for providing advanced end-to-end operational support for securities, loans, exchange traded derivatives and over the counter derivatives across multiple lines of business, and cross-business functional support through the lifecycle of a trade. Key responsibilities include ensuring trading and operational activities are completed accurately and before deadlines, researching and resolving complex issues, and simplifying client interactions. Job expectations include being customer oriented and data driven, while focusing on continuous improvement.

LOB Job Description:

Provides technical and analytical support in a Global Markets Loan Operations function for one or more operations product areas. Responsible for the analysis and resolution of complex operations problems and initiatives requiring exceptional handling and/or coordination of multiple operational and/or product specialists to resolve. May manage projects and/or the introduction of new initiatives, systems, products/services and processes, coordinating necessary expertise across multiple operations functions and/or products. As a technical expert, may also function as an informal team lead, providing work direction and technical guidance to less experienced employees in resolving complex transactions and operational problems. Requires extensive experience in an operations support function with thorough working knowledge of fundamental business structure and operational aspects for specific transactions and products. As a technical expert, will consult on a wide variety of topics across functional and business support lines.  

Responsibilities:

  • Provides operational support for one or more activities within the lifecycle of a trade, including trade processing, trade settlement, accounting and reconciliation, lifecycle events, and collateral management
  • Provides simplified client interactions and deepens client relationships across Global Banking and Markets' clients
  • Completes accurate, timely clearing and settlement of trades with internal and external counterparties including reconciliation management and governance of trade fails and breaks
  • Performs tasks accurately during high volume periods in a team environment
  • Improves and simplifies the client experience, reducing manual touchpoints
  • Supports the implementation of new processes to improve the overall business operating model
  • Identifies and flags potential risks in a timely manner
  • The role involves providing support for the various US based Loan Operations teams in relation to Data Quality, Control monitoring and assistance, automation and process overnight.
  • Day-to-day actions are more focused on providing managerial support and QA review within the teams.
  • Functions could include technical enhancements and process review along with suggestions for enhancements and management of process change.
